    CUCV M1028 Compatability with civian Blazer? (14 bolt front and rear, front bumper.)

    m1028s don't have 14 bolts front and rear. they have a dana 60 front with a limited slip and a 14 bolt full floater rear with a Detroit Locker, and both axles have 4.56 gears. good call taking a girl mudding, dinner is the back is cute too. well played :) bad call: you went wheeling unprepared...

    comparison m1008 to m1009

    the M1009 comes in the SUV version your seen, the Chevy Blazer. The pickup version is the M1008. the 09 is a 1/2 ton SUV. it's rated at 3/4 ton by the military but it has 1/2 ton axles. the 08 is a 1 ton pickup. it has different axles. it's rated at 5/4 ton (1 and a quarter) by the army...
